Political editor Joe Murphy joins the show to look into the questions mounting following the resignation of Matt Hancock as health secretary.

He tells us senior Conservative and Labour MPs are calling for answers over how often Mr. Hancock used a private email account, and whether he used it to discuss NHS business with family members and a friend who went on to win public sector contracts.

And he says the heat’s also turning on the Prime Minister, as MPs on all sides protest that Downing Street is failing to uphold high standards in public officer, or discipline senior ministers who fall short.
